Web10.3 Prime and Primitive Polynomials A polynomial is prime, if it cannot be factored down into polynomials of lesser degree. 1 + x2 + x5 for example is prime, 1 + x2 + x4 is not …
WebSearch for Primitive Trinomials (mod 2) Consider polynomials over the finite field GF(2) of two elements {0, 1}. A polynomial with only three nonzero terms is called a trinomial.. In particular, you can specify modulus="primitive" to get a … bliss thonglorWebExample: We will find the minimal polynomials of all the elements of GF(8). First of all, the elements 0 and 1 will have minimal polynomials x and x + 1 respectively.
